Ticket: TilePrefetch credentials expired

The TileGrab prefetcher stopped pulling map tiles overnight because its service credential expired; users will see stale or missing tiles in offline regions until caches refill. No action needed from support beyond pointing customers to this ticket. A new credential has been issued and deployment is scheduled for today. For reference, the replacement key is below.

app token of bawep-hafog = kto7_vwrmnlx

Tracing at Corvassel: every inbound request gets a trace ID at the gateway; services propagate it via the standard header. Sampling is 10% in prod, 100% in staging. Trace storage is read-only except for the trace-admin account. Recovering that account requires its recovery passphrase, appended immediately below for the review record.

unlock words, yawig-kagef: gordor-holvan-ulaael-pramir-ulaiel-tamdor

14:22 — Confirmed the Harkwell orders table was never partitioned by month as planned; the migration landed on staging only. Full-table scans explain the 14:05 latency spike. Rolled read traffic to the Quillmere replica, queued the partitioning backfill for the weekend window. Action: add a drift check comparing staging and prod DDL. The replica build we failed over to is recorded below.

pipeline stamp: htk9_6ce9d33c5